Transaction 52fb9b612807e657b6019821d5d83a1fe679e4590e72a9a52df68c3907f9f4cd

1 Input
2 Outputs
  • 52fb9b612807e657b6019821d5d83a1fe679e4590e72a9a52df68c3907f9f4cd:0
  • value  21079
    address  12vuzxf7qgtidtDV9S83qkbLD6ybo54Gqh
  • 52fb9b612807e657b6019821d5d83a1fe679e4590e72a9a52df68c3907f9f4cd:1
  • value  500000
    address  1GHp8dRH1RANsbhxe5dc63qnLf8CACzgps